NSC | Transaction Dist.>System Notes Show Diff. Users: Who Created Transaction vs Who Ran the Script
Scenario
When utilizing the Transaction Dist. SuiteApp, user would like to know why do the system notes show that the journal was created by a different user? The system notes on the Bill reflect different users: one who created the transaction and another who executed the Transaction Dist. Processing script. Does the Map/Reduce script randomly select an employee, or are there specific conditions triggering this behavior?
Below is the system notes from the Bill
Below is the log from the Advanced Intercompany Journal created from the Bill
Solution
If the script ran automatically, it should display -system- instead of a user. Please see below the difference if it has been run automatically or manually deployed.
